While attending summer camp, the 12-year-old son of long-married Macon and Sarah is brutally murdered at a fast-food restaurant. A year after the crime, still finding it difficult to cope with their loss, the couple separate. Macon, who writes travel books for businessmen, continues to isolate himself from the world until a free-spirited dog trainer challenges him to start a new life. [More]

Reviews
Kasdan's film lacks the spirit of Tyler's novel; he seems to be the wrong director to translate the author's affectionate and humorous treatment of the characters. Fortunately, Geena Davis as the eccentric dog-walker elevates the otherwise morose mood.
A genuinely beautiful and human story out of the Hollywood mills. Subtly amazing work from all concerned.
This is a warm movie told in the temperature of almost-recognizable life; it's a believable love story, joked up a bit but not too much.
